Porchlight – a NPR “Moth Radio Hour” inspired storytelling program produced at the Cherry Center for the Arts is offering a workshop for would be storytellers! The next performance of Porchlight will be held October 29, 2026.

Workshop Leader: Robin McKee – Longtime Director, Producer and Performance Coach, Robin McKee, will guide a small group of storytellers through crafting,  editing and live presentation on stage – 1 to 3 stories.

Workshop takes place at the Cherry Center for the Arts (4th and Guadalupe, Carmel-by-the-Sea)

10:30am – 1:30 pm – Public Reading, Crafting and Editing Material with group and input.

1:30 – 2:15 pm – Working lunch break – for individual re-writes and BYOB lunch/refreshment in the Sculpture Garden at the Cherry Center

2:15 – 5:30 pm – One-on-one stage rehearsal of stories continuing to carve and shape individual’s stories with coaching from Robin.

Round-table storytelling experience

5:30 – 8:00 pm – Light dinner (pizza anyone?) and adult beverages (provided by workshop organizers)

Time to relax and refresh followed by telling of refined and rehearsed stories in a “dining room/friends and family” setting. Maybe we will have time for you to tell a brand new story with your freshly honed skills.

Saturday, August 29th All day workshop with dinner provided: $75 per person. Space is limited.
